Walkway Replacement in Salt Lake City, UT
Walkway replacement services involve removing and replacing existing walkways to improve safety, functionality, and appearance.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ing cracked or damaged concrete, paver pathways, brick walkways, or stone paths. Homeowners typically seek walkway replacement when their current surfaces show signs of wear, cracking, or unevenness, or when they want to update the style of their outdoor space. Before requesting this service, property owners usually want to understand the different material options available, the scope of work involved, and how the new walkway will enhance the property's curb appeal and accessibility.
Property owners should consider factors such as the location and size of the walkway, the materials that best suit their landscape, and any necessary permits or regulations in their area. It's also helpful to think about drainage, maintenance requirements, and how the replacement will integrate with existing landscaping. Clarifying these details can ensure the project aligns with aesthetic preferences and practical needs, resulting in a durable and visually appealing walkway that complements the overall property.

Common Walkway Replacement Jobs
Concrete walkways - replacement services restore safety and curb appeal to residential paths.
Stamped walkways - upgrading to decorative designs enhances outdoor aesthetics.
Cracked or damaged walkways - replacement addresses safety hazards and prevents further deterioration.
Uneven or sinking walkways - leveling and replacement create a smooth, stable surface.
Old or worn concrete - replacement improves the functionality and appearance of property entrances.
Permeable or decorative walkways - installation options offer both style and drainage benefits.
Walkway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ace a walkway? Walkways may need replacement due to cracks, uneven surfaces, or damage from weather and age.
What materials are used for walkway replacement? Typical materials include concrete, pavers, brick, and stamped concrete, chosen based on style and durability.
How can I tell if my walkway needs replacement? Signs include large cracks, shifting or sinking sections, and significant surface deterioration.
What should property owners consider before replacing a walkway? Factors include the existing layout, desired materials, and ensuring proper drainage and safety features.
